Output 2ac2596adfbbd038a64e9bdf80679e541ee3e4662ee1090b13bfa2601e1fc944:0

value
25146241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95daefcfa66c466fd66c6fe18e7dbc1528290177 OP_EQUAL
address
3FMNt7sx9SpxfaM7onUtSwaTJ8b4oRBCTJ
transaction
2ac2596adfbbd038a64e9bdf80679e541ee3e4662ee1090b13bfa2601e1fc944
confirmations
178682
spent
true